Output 3f91f5f7c542f77150e0068cd9fca089a7ec6cfe9c84c8f9509cf275e533ff91:6

value
448182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b0bdd8f7885759008a1b02cb32a14560cbb413 OP_EQUAL
address
3QuhHVMr9syZV59gFpu7uV8zbNx54pko2V
transaction
3f91f5f7c542f77150e0068cd9fca089a7ec6cfe9c84c8f9509cf275e533ff91
confirmations
175892
spent
true